The differences between tutor coordinators and after school program coordinators can be seen in a few details. Each job has different responsibilities and duties. Additionally, a tutor coordinator has an average salary of $40,144, which is higher than the $34,475 average annual salary of an after school program coordinator.
The top three skills for a tutor coordinator include mathematics, math and academic support. The most important skills for an after school program coordinator are CPR, child care, and incident reports.
